X-ray structures of heteroleptic zinc(II) complexes involving combinations of O,O'-dialkyldithiophosphato and bidentate N-donor ligands

2014 
The detailed X-ray structural elucidation of reaction products of a zinc(II) salt with O,O'-dialkyl- dithiophosphate and nitrogen-containing heterocycles (N-N = 1,10-phenanthroline (phen) or 2,2'-bipyridine (bpy)) has been performed. Surprisingly, together with (Zn(S 2 P(OR) 2 ) 2 (N-N)) compounds, also ionic-type com- plexes having the formula of (Zn(N-N) 3 )(S 2 P(OR) 2 ) 2 have been obtained using the same molar ratios of the reac- tants. The prepared complexes have been characterized by elemental analysis and single-crystal X-ray analysis. The crystallographic analysis showed that the bond lengths and bite angles of the prepared complexes are in good agreement with those of similar compounds. The crystal packing of described complexes is formed via π-π stack- ing interactions and/or C-H···S non-covalent contacts.
